Output f8e0eadd03f9cb6f8ea78d55ea80c54a2a87818da16677480f12e54f77d34725:1

value
2572658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3292e00df064ca000d6d782a90a5e970f26ac2 OP_EQUAL
address
3D1iJFkgHyRY6zSJBun8pXA2dHqHw7PEkV
transaction
f8e0eadd03f9cb6f8ea78d55ea80c54a2a87818da16677480f12e54f77d34725
confirmations
271744
spent
true